What is Iridology?
"Iridology" is the study of the iris, the colored part of the eye, to gain insights into an individual's overall health and nutritional status.
The iris is unique in that it is the only visible part of the body where nerve reflex tissue can be observed without specialized equipment. A skilled iridologist carefully examines the iris to assess a person’s strengths, weaknesses, genetic predispositions, stressed organ systems, and potential vitamin or mineral deficiencies.
